Bova Double Leg Shock Absorbing Lanyard
The Bova Double Leg Shock Absorbing Lanyard (LANY01220) is a professional fall arrest solution engineered for safe, continuous attachment when working at height. Designed with a dual-leg configuration and integrated energy absorber, it allows users to transition between anchor points without disconnecting, ensuring maximum safety and mobility in demanding industrial environments.
Key Features
- 🔗 Dual-leg design enables continuous attachment while navigating structures
- ⚡ Integrated shock absorber reduces fall impact forces to less than 6kN
- 🪢 45mm UV-resistant polyester webbing with 2.6 tonne minimum breaking load
- 🪝 Two corrosion-resistant scaffolding hooks (50mm gate, 23kN strength)
- 🔒 One corrosion-resistant snap hook (20mm gate, 22kN strength)
- 📏 Working length: 1,750mm (intact) with extension up to 3,450mm when deployed
- 🏗️ Designed for fall arrest systems with dorsal D-ring harness connection

How to Use
- Attach the snap hook to the dorsal D-ring of a certified fall arrest harness.
- Secure one scaffolding hook to a suitable anchor point before movement.
- Attach the second hook to the next anchor point before releasing the first.
- Ensure the shock absorber is intact and not previously deployed before use.
- Inspect all connectors, webbing, and stitching prior to each use.
⚠️ Always ensure the maximum user weight of 140kg is not exceeded and never use the lanyard if the shock absorber has been deployed or shows signs of damage.

FAQs
- Q: What is the purpose of the double leg design?
A: It allows continuous attachment by keeping one leg secured while repositioning the other. - Q: Is this lanyard suitable for outdoor use?
A: Yes, the UV-resistant polyester webbing is designed for outdoor and harsh environments. - Q: What type of harness is required?
A: A certified fall arrest harness with a dorsal D-ring is required. - Q: What happens during a fall?
A: The integrated energy absorber deploys to reduce impact forces to below 6kN. - Q: Can the lanyard be reused after a fall?
A: No, it must be removed from service if the shock absorber has deployed.
